Secondary Glazing Energy-Saving: Enhancing Home Efficiency

In the quest for energy efficiency, homeowners and builders are continuously searching for solutions that strike a balance between convenience, looks, and cost. One method that has gained traction in current years is secondary glazing-- a method that not just assists reduce energy usage however likewise boosts the total comfort of a home. This post looks into the benefits of secondary glazing, its installation process, and how it can result in considerable energy cost savings.

What is Secondary Glazing?

Secondary glazing involves the installation of a 2nd layer of glazing to existing windows. This extra layer develops an insulating air space between the 2 panes, which can considerably reduce heat loss throughout chillier months. Unlike complete window replacements, secondary glazing is frequently a more cost-effective and less disruptive alternative, making it particularly appealing for older buildings or homes with traditional window styles.

Benefits of Secondary Glazing

Secondary glazing provides a wide variety of advantages, particularly with regard to energy efficiency and convenience. Below are some of the crucial benefits:

  1. Energy Savings: The main benefit of secondary glazing is its ability to lower energy usage. By substantially decreasing heat loss from windows, homes can reduce their heating costs during winter months.

  3. Increased Comfort: Maintaining a constant indoor temperature level leads to greater convenience year-round.

  4. Environment Control: In addition to keeping heat in, secondary glazing can help keep structures cool in summer season, thus lowering the need for cooling.

The Installation Process

The installation of secondary glazing can be finished by a professional or as a DIY project, depending on the homeowner's ability level and know-how. The list below steps detail a common installation process:

  1. Measurement: Measure the existing window frames to ensure a correct fit for the secondary glazing systems.

  2. Selection of Glazing Type: Choose the kind of secondary glazing that matches your needs-- options consist of acrylic, polycarbonate, or low-emissivity glass.

  3. Structure Choice: Depending on your preference, you can decide for repaired frames, sliding windows, or hinged designs.

  4. Installation:

    • Preparing the Area: Clean the window frames and guarantee a level surface for the installation.
    • Fitting the Frame: Secure the secondary glazing frame to the existing window frame utilizing screws, adhesive, or magnetic strips.
    • Sealing: Apply weather removing or silicone sealant to avoid air leakage.
  5. Finishing Touches: Ensure the unit opens and closes effectively (if appropriate) and include any completing trim desired for aesthetics.

FAQs About Secondary Glazing

1. Is secondary glazing ideal for all types of windows?

Yes, secondary glazing can be fitted to different window styles, consisting of casement, sliding, sash, and arched windows.

2. Can I set up secondary glazing myself?

It is possible to install secondary glazing as a DIY project if you have the required abilities. Nevertheless, employing a professional is recommended for best outcomes.

3. How much will secondary glazing cost?

Expenses differ depending upon elements such as the kind of glazing, size of the windows, and whether installation is done professionally or as a DIY job. Generally, property owners can anticipate to pay in between ₤ 300 to ₤ 700 per window.

4. How long does it take to install secondary glazing?

Installation usually takes a couple of hours per window, depending upon the complexity of the job and the skill level of the installer.

5. Just how much energy can I conserve with secondary glazing?

Typically, secondary glazing can minimize heating costs by 20-40%, depending on aspects such as place, window age, and quality of installation.
